  1. Cellular Respiration 4 tab Foldable Ch. 6

  2. Foldable Set up Instructions: • Fold paper so you have 4 tabs, about an inch each (2 sheets of paper) • Label each tab • Overview • Stage 1: Glycolysis • Stage 2: Citric Acid Cycle (Krebs Cycle) • Stage 3: Oxidative Phosphorylation (Electron Transport Chain)

  3. Cellular Respiration: How Cells Harvest Energy Overview Stage 1: Glycolysis Stage 2: Citric Acid Cycle (Krebs cycle) Stage 3: Oxidative Phosphorylation

  4. Overview : Top tabset up • Title at the top : • “Cellular Respiration: How Cells Harvest Energy” • Center of page: Draw 2 diagrams from textbook Fig. 6.6 p.93 Fig. 6.3 p.91 Overall Summary Equations

Stage1: Glycolysis set up (2nd tab) Top tab- Title at the top “Overview of Glycolysis” • Center of page: Draw diagram Lower tab: • Center of page label “Intermediates” and leave blank with room to draw! (We’ll do this together!) • Lower part of page: Describe the main steps of the glycolysis in your own words. Fig. 6.7A p.94

Stage2: Citric Acid Cycle set up (3rd tab) Top tab- Title at the top “Pyruvate links glycolysis and citric acid cycle” • Center of page: Draw diagram ____________________________________________ Lower tab: Title at the top “Overview of citric acid cycle” Left side of page: Draw diagram Right side of page: Describe the main steps of the citric acid cycle in your own words. Fig. 6.8 p.96 Fig. 6.9A p.96

  7. Stage3: Oxidative Phosphorylation set up (4th tab) Top tab-Describe the main steps of oxidative phosphor. in your own words. ________________________________________ Lower tab: Title at the top “Overview of Oxidative Phosphorylation” Center of page: Draw diagram Fig. 6.10 p.98

  8. Back of Foldable set up Title at the top “Anaerobic Process: Fermentation” Center of page: Draw diagrams Lower page: Describe each type of fermentation, in your own words. Fig. 6.13A p.101 Fig. 6.13B p.101
